CommandCreation.MaskParser.GetMaskFromTagsAndSplits C# (CSharp) 메소드

GetMaskFromTagsAndSplits() 공개 메소드

public GetMaskFromTagsAndSplits ( ) : string
리턴 string
        public string GetMaskFromTagsAndSplits()
        {
            var mask = new StringBuilder();
            int i = 0;
            while (i < _tags.Count)
            {
                mask.Append(_splits[i]);
                mask.Append(_tags[i]);
                i++;
            }
            mask.Append(_splits[i]);
            return mask.ToString();
        }

Usage Example

예제 #1
0
        public void CleanUp()
        {
            var parser = new MaskParser(_expectedMask);

            Assert.AreEqual(_expectedMask, parser.GetMaskFromTagsAndSplits());
            CollectionAssert.AreEqual(_expectedTags, parser.GetTags());
            CollectionAssert.AreEqual(_expectedSplits, parser.GetSplits());
        }